This application is a division of my United States application for Letters Patent, Serial No. 402,864, filed July 17, 1941, for Vise stands, and now abandoned.
One of my objects is to provide a vise structure adapted for use interchangeably as a yoke type of vise or a, chain type of vise.
Another object is to provide a simple and economical construction of vise of the yoke type wherein the yoke may be reversed; and other objects as will be understood from the following description.

The illustrated structure comprises in general a support It shown as in the form of a plate which may be secured to a bench or be provided, as desired, with legs (not shown) to form a stand.
The plate support I0 is provided with two pairs II and I2 of upwardly extending spaced apart lugs located at opposite sides of the medial line of the structure. The support It between the lugs |2, has a vertical downwardly tapering opening I3, at opposite sides of which lugs [4 having inturned lips I5, are disposed, and between the lugs H is provided with upper and lower pairs I6 and I! of double hooks.
Between the pairs of lugs H and I2 are downwardly converging seats |8 for jaw blocks [9 shown as of the reversible type, detachably secured to these seats by screws 20.
Referring now to the yoke type vise means shown in Figs. 1, 2, 3 and 4, and used in operating on the smaller diameters of pipes, the lower fixed jaw of the vise comprises the stationarily supported jaw-plates l9, and an upper movable jaw 2| carried by a yoke 22. The yoke 221s positioned between the lugs of each pair H and I2, one leg 23 of the yoke 22 being shown as pivoted to the lugs H by a removable and replaceable bolt 24 extending through the lugs Hand the yoke-leg 23. The other leg 25 of the yoke 22 is provided with a latch bar 26 pivoted at its upper end to the leg 25 at 21 and adapted at its lower hook end 28 to engage beneath a removable and replaceable bolt 29 secured to the lugs l2.
Slidable vertically in the yoke 22 is a cross head 30 to which the upper jaw 2| is rigidly secured. Threaded in the cross bar 3| of the yoke 22 is a vertically disposed screw between the lower end of which and the jaw 2| a hardened steel ball 33 located in an opening 34 in the cross head 30 for taking the thrust exerted by the screw 32 in clamping a pipe, such as that illustrated at 35 in the vise, is interposed. The lower end of the screw 32 is journaled in the cross head 30 and projects into a space 36 within the cross head where it is provided with a collar 31 rigidly secured to the screw and serving as a means for lifting the cross head 30 and with it the upper jaw 2|, when the screw 32 is retracted.
As will be understood by providing for the interlocking of the latch 26 with one of the bolts the necessity for providing a lug or lugs onthe base portion of the vise for interlocking with the latch, is eliminated.
Furthermore, the provision of the vise as shown and described permits the yoke to be pivoted on either one of the bolts 24 and 29 as desired thereby rendering the yoke reversible, the bolt which in the particular positioning of the yoke does not form a pivot, affording a surface with which to latch the lever 26.
Referring now to the chain type of vise shown in Figs. 5-8 and usable more particularly in operating on pipes of the larger diameters, the lower fixed jaw of the vise comprises the stationarily supported jaw plates I9 and a chain 38 for looping over the pipe 35, one end of the chain being connected with a screw 39 extending through the opening |3 in the supporting member III, the screw 39 being threaded in a nut 40 which bears upwardly against the wall of the opening l3 and is provided with a handle 4| for rotating it. The other, free end of the chain 38 extends between the hooks of the pairs l6 and I1 thereof and is adapted at extensions 42 of its link-connecting pins to be engaged with the appropriate pairs of the hooks as is customary with chain type vises.
